2.4 GHz Bluetooth Power Amplifier ICA monolithic, high-efficiency, silicon-germanium power
Amplifier IC, the SE2425U is designed for 2.4 GHz
Wireless applications, including BluetoothTM Class 1
basic rate and enhanced data rate applications. It
delivers +25 dBm output power in standard rate GFSK
mode and +19.5 dBm output power in enhanced rate
8DPSK.
The SE2425U provides a digital mode control input for
boosting the linear performance for enhanced data rate
applications.
The SE2425U operates at 3.3 V DC with a peak
efficiency of 43 % in basic rate and 21 % in enhanced
rate mode. The internal bias management allows the
part to only draw 28 mA in Class 2 output power levels.
Output match integrates the high Q inductors to reduce
component count and bill of materials. It uses two
external capacitors to allow for varying loads, such as
switches and Filters in different applications.
The silicon/silicon-germanium structure of the
SE2425U and its exposed die-pad package, soldered
to the system PCB, provide high thermal conductivity
and a subsequently low junction temperature. This
device is capable of operating at a duty cycle of 100
percent. By SiGe Semiconductor
